## Tuning

Date localization in Cartwheel runs through the `fmtclock` layer. Locale packs load lazily; cache them or startup drags. Fallback chains are short on purpose — long chains hide missing packs. Don't widen the parse tolerance without checking the Varnholm QA suite first. If a locale renders wrong, check pack version before touching constants. Current tuning values follow.

tuning constants:
RATE_LIMITS = {
    "wenwyn": 1,
    "zorix": 10,
    "oliix": 2,
    "holael": 10,
}

## Environments: Flintwick Metrics Sidecar

The flintwick-agg sidecar runs alongside every pod in the Tarnwell service mesh, collecting counters and histograms before forwarding them to the central Graywater aggregator. Staging and production use identical images; only the flush interval and buffer sizes differ. Note that the sidecar reads its settings at startup only, so any change requires a pod restart. Future maintainers should verify buffer limits after scaling events. The current production configuration values are listed below.

deployment values, faduf-tawep:
SORDOR_LOG_LEVEL=error
SORDOR_METRICS_HOST=metrics.sordor.nelvrolabs.internal
SORDOR_POOL_SIZE=4

## Authentication

The Ledgerlight audit-log viewer requires a bearer token on every request, including read-only queries. Please never commit tokens to the repository or paste them into shared channels; rotate immediately if exposure is suspected. Tokens are issued per contractor and expire weekly. For your onboarding in the staging environment, authenticate with the token below.

login token, kajef-bageg: eyJhbGciOiJIUzI1NiIsInR5cCI6IkpXVCJ9.eyJzdWIiOiIH5ZQCtYjwtIn0.4vgGyGsw5y_7